a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rw-r--r--BACKPORTING96
1 files changed, 95 insertions, 1 deletions
diff --git a/BACKPORTING b/BACKPORTING
index 73852b0ac..8724c2755 100644
--- a/BACKPORTING
+++ b/BACKPORTING
@@ -613,4 +613,98 @@ branch), or have information worth noting.
8152:3481e13acf88 Making dependencies now requires Python 3.6+.
8153:5dfb47531eef Update Python versions.
8154:7a8ff85aa5a8 Update Python versions for files that may involve PySide on Linux
- Not backported in an attempt to keep support for Python 2.7.
+ Not backported in an attempt to keep support for Python 2.7.
+
+8204:f0951477de32 Added tag rel-4-3-3 for changeset 4c6aee014e72
+8206:fdfe04eeff0e Fixed link.
+ Not backported, as this is LongTerm3.
+
+8207:f2a312bb0ff9 Add tests for errorlist lexer.
+8208:51662a65c520 Add tests for mmixal lexer.
+8211:ede3d559ad4a Fix line ends on example files.
+8214:c6536b577dfe Add a script to make it easier to test lexers on Unix.
+ Not backported, as Lexilla is not supported.
+
+8229:c88f8cdede65 Feature [feature-requests:1347]. Optimize large insertions
+ Backported, but with a "reinterpret_cast<>" in place of "if constexpr()". This
+ shouldn't be an issue, but if so, it will be when largeDocument is true.
+
+8233:fe9919b45dde Support Windows XP.
+8234:47ee096230fe Set calling convention to stdcall to match clients and old DLL lexers and export names undecorated.
+8235:dcdc684baa3a On Unix call shared object liblexilla instead of lexilla to match platform convention.
+8236:1b4a98fe81fd Produce a shared object libscintilla.so that can be dynamically linked to.
+8237:9924c5344c5a Remove lexers from libscintilla.lib / libscintilla.a.
+8238:7563800da018 Ensure Lexilla built as well.
+ Not backported, as Lexilla is not supported.
+
+8240:1348ba71e4b6 Use pathlib in generator scripts.
+ Not backported in an attempt to keep support for Python 2.7.
+
+8241:711a07441bfc Update version.
+ Not backported, as Lexilla is not supported.
+
+8245:84f6361d238b SciTE change log.
+8247:42e7939c902b Update download sizes.
+ Not backported, as this is LongTerm3.
+
+8251:5e4fb5bdfc0a Add Xcode project for Lexilla.
+8252:40c090f1d8e3 Added Info.plist to hold name and version.
+8253:29e21f17c77f Update Lexilla Xcode project with new lexers and changed version number.
+8254:7680d60e4438 Hide Visual Studio solution files from Mercurial.
+ Not backported, as Lexilla is not supported.
+
+8255:96b4a77ad9db Add file that avoids extra upgrade checks.
+ Not backported, as it is for newer versions of XCode.
+
+8256:030106247f11 Add new project that builds a Scintilla framework with no lexers.
+ Not backported, as Lexilla is not supported.
+
+8259:9eb5513f9887 Regenerate version numbers in cocoa/Scintilla project.
+ Not backported, as cocoa versioning is probably not needed and would require some Python script backporting.
+
+8260:cd73c86aadae Save and restore current directory around dependency generation in source directory.
+8262:27dde1067ce0 Update instructions for separate Lexilla.
+ Not backported, as Lexilla is not supported.
+
+8269:02f64387e1e6 Updates for 4.4.0.
+8270:cf480284c27e Change log.
+8271:12e2a7acacec Change log.
+8272:2cec461c9531 Added tag rel-4-4-0 for changeset 12e2a7acacec
+ Not backported, as this is LongTerm3.
+
+8273:21000fa93341 Use @rpath as dylib install path as otherwise expects /usr/lib.
+8274:ad039bcac9a0 Make Lexilla run on old macOS by setting deployment target to 10.8.
+8275:23834927ce81 Specify the calling convention so that both dynamic and static linking work on 32-bit and 64-bit Win32.
+ Not backported, as Lexilla is not supported.
+
+8276:41a534b0add8 Updates for 4.4.2.
+8277:9e2209bc5dc8 Added tag rel-4-4-2 for changeset 41a534b0add8
+8278:464c94dd39c2 Updates for 4.4.3.
+8279:e454eae1f1eb Added bug reference.
+8280:a402218b9494 Added tag rel-4-4-3 for changeset e454eae1f1eb
+ Not backported, as this is LongTerm3.
+
+8281:24f3e50b1355 Fix list in documentation.
+ Not backported, as this applies to a Lexilla change that was not backported.
+
+8282:7dbe86a38c18 Use pathlib.
+ Not backported in an attempt to keep support for Python 2.7.
+
+8283:2a5262659fe0 Defer most initialisation until Scintilla window is created.
+8284:6ca6c0a02a93 Use call_once for initialising Direct2D so only done once even with threads.
+ Not backported, as my Windows compiler does not support C++11 threading
+ facilities, and I cannot test this.
+
+8287:f8749b773e12 Prefer .data() over &[0] as more explicit.
+ Backported, but without C++17 and C++20 features.
+
+8292:96f2097aebc7 Add test for latex lexer.
+ Not backported, as Lexilla is not supported.
+
+8294:82dc5f8e49ff Removed extra end tag.
+8303:dca178e47b29 Add include that defines back_inserter.
+ Not backported, as this applies to a change that was not backported.
+
+8304:c010c1851c8a Fixed path mentioned in comment.
+8311:f0910912700f Change log for SciTE.
+ Not backported, as Lexilla is not supported.